There are two main ways a cat rubs their human friends—something called head bunting and leg rubbing. Rubbing their body around your legs or engaging in head bunting, are the ultimate signs of affection where your cat is concerned and shows that they feel safe and secure. Cats rubbing their heads against you is one of many behaviors of body language that cats have to show love and affection. Marking you with their scent.
